About The Role

As Senior Cloud Engineer, you will be asked to:

  • Lead project activities, including solution demonstrations, workshops, and the preparation of design and as-built documentation
  • Conduct technical feasibility studies, system configurations, and deliver solution presentations to technical and client executives
  • Stay up to date with the latest innovations in Cloud, AI, Automation & Modern workplace technologies to serve as a subject matter expert to clients and internal teams
  • Be ready to engage and support other team members by learning new technologies and skills
  • Provide technical leadership and escalation to Technical Architect and Cloud Engineers
  • Lead the customer workshop and confidently present and discuss the technical and commercial aspects of the solution
  • Design, document and implement various cloud projects for existing and/or new customers
  • Provide proactive support to ensure the customer's environment is running smoothly and assist in resolving issues by adhering to customer SLAs
  • Identify and troubleshoot issues related to cloud infrastructure, applications, and services, ensuring timely resolution to minimize impact on business operations
  • Document incidents, resolutions, and best practices to build a knowledge base and facilitate continuous improvement
  • Raise required changes and prepare for change approval as per customer request
  • Proactively maintain the customer environment from a monitoring, backup and patching perspective
  • Assist with project implementation, updating as-built and design documentation
  • Monitor the health and performance of cloud infrastructure and services, including virtual machines, storage, networking, security and PaaS services
  • Collaborate with internal team and client to address technical issues and requirements
  • Stay up to date on the latest Microsoft Azure features, updates, and best practices to serve as a subject matter expert to clients and internal teams
  • Engage and support other team members by learning new technologies and skills

This role requires some on-call shifts on a distributed roster; you must be flexible in your availability.

About You

As an experienced Cloud Engineer, you will ideally bring Azure (or AWS or GCP) certifications, as well as:

  • Hands-on experience in managing and maintaining large cloud environments
  • Experience in managing and troubleshooting Azure Virtual Machines, cloud networking, hybrid connectivity, and Azure Storage
  • Experience in managing and troubleshooting App Services, Azure App Gateways, AKS, ACR and ACI
  • Experience in managing and troubleshooting Azure Front Door, Traffic Manager, and Managed DB services
  • Experience in managing and troubleshooting Azure firewall, Defender for Cloud, Advisor, and well-architected framework
  • Fluency in writing PowerShell scripts and KQL queries
  • Knowledge of IaC such as Terraform
  • Linux skills desirable
  • Strong commercial acumen to identify and develop leads, partnering with the Sales team
  • Ability to articulate desired state outcomes for clients and the ROI delivered through engagements
  • Collaborative, team-focused and outcome driven approach, with an ongoing emphasis on learning and continuous improvement
  • Experience migrating on-premises workload to Azure
  • Ability to articulate business outcomes including the implications and risks of findings in relation to the business goals of our clients
  • Understanding of client requirements and business challenges and provide appropriate technical solutions that are simple, cost effective and scalable
